Latest Patents
Jainye Zhang holds a patent for a "Substantially transparent display substrate, substantially transparent display apparatus, and method of fabricating substantially transparent display substrate." This invention provides a novel approach to creating a transparent display substrate that includes a base substrate, multiple insulating layers, and grooves in the insulating layers. The design allows for a display area with subpixel regions that feature both light-emitting and transparent sub-regions, enhancing the overall display quality.
